“Only People Made of Darkness Can Deny That Light Has Come to Abia” – Dr. Uche Sampson Ogah

Former Minister of State for Mines and Steel Development, Dr. Uche Sampson Ogah, CON, has declared that anyone still denying the transformation currently taking place in Abia State is simply opposed to progress and blinded by darkness.

Speaking while addressing journalists in Umuahia, Dr. Ogah stated, “It is only people that are made of darkness that can deny that light has come to Abia State.” He explained that Abia, for years, had suffered under stagnation, mismanagement, and neglect, but is now witnessing visible changes that every honest observer can attest to.

According to him, governance should be about impact, transparency, and service to the people, values he said are now being restored in the state. Dr. Ogah noted that beyond political affiliations, it is time for Abians to unite behind any leadership that genuinely prioritizes development and accountability.

“What matters is not which political party is in charge, but whether the government is delivering on its promises to the people,” he emphasized. “When roads are being constructed, salaries are being paid, and hope is being restored, only those who prefer darkness will deny that light has come.”

Dr. Ogah urged citizens to rise above partisanship and support initiatives aimed at rebuilding the state’s infrastructure and reviving its economy. He added that those who choose to criticize progress for selfish political reasons are doing a disservice to the people they claim to represent.

The former minister reaffirmed his commitment to a better Abia, stating that constructive collaboration among stakeholders remains the only way to sustain the new wave of development sweeping across the state.
